R&J Act 3

Romeo and Juliet

QuestionAnswer
Why does Benvolio think that he and Mercutio should go somewhere else? It is a hot summer day and there are many Capulets around. Benvolio is worried that if they run into Capulets, there will be a fight.
Why does Tybalt want to fight Romeo? Tybalt wants to fight Romeo because he thought that Romeo disrespected him by showing up at the party.
Why does Romeo say that he now loves Tybalt? Because Romeo just married Juliet, Tybalt and Romeo are now cousins-in-law. He is also trying to explain why he doesn’t want to fight Tybalt.
What happens to Mercutio? Mercutio is stabbed by Tybalt. Romeo is trying to stop the fighting and Tybalt stabs Mercutio under Romeo’s arm.
What happens to Tybalt? Tybalt is killed by Romeo. Romeo is so upset that Tybalt killed Mercutio that Romeo fights with Tybalt and kills Tybalt.
Why doesn’t Lady Capulet believe Benvolio’s story? She says that Benvolio’s version of the story is biased because Benvolio is Romeo’s friend.
What declaration does Lady Capulet make about Romeo? She says that Romeo must be killed because Romeo killed Tybalt.
Why does Juliet want night to arrive so quickly? Juliet wants night to arrive so that she can see Romeo. He has to be sneaky since he cannot be seen in Verona.
Who does Juliet think was killed? She thinks Romeo was killed.
How does Juliet react initially when she hears that Romeo killed Tybalt? Juliet is shocked at first and untrusting of Romeo. She is doubting Romeo’s intentions and his character.
Why does she then change her mind? The Nurse speaks badly of Romeo which causes Juliet to get defensive of him. She is too in love with him to go against him now.
Where is Romeo hiding? Romeo is hiding in Friar Lawrence’s cell.
What is the nurse going to do for Juliet? The Nurse tells Juliet she knows where Romeo is and that she will find him and bring him to Juliet.
Why does Romeo think that banishment is worse than death? He thinks that banishment is worse than death because he will not be able to see Juliet.
How does the friar respond to this reaction of Romeo’s? He is critical of Romeo because Romeo is not appreciating all of the “blessings” that Romeo has received. Friar Lawrence thinks that Romeo should be happy that the Prince did not have Romeo executed.

What decision has Capulet made for Juliet? He has decided that Juliet will marry Paris on Thursday. It is currently Monday.
Of what is Juliet trying to convince Romeo at the beginning of this scene? Juliet is trying to convince Romeo that it is still night so that he does not have to leave her.
What makes her change her mind? She realizes that it is the Lark (a bird that sings in the morning) that is chirping and not the Nightingale.
Why does Lady Capulet think that Juliet is crying? She thinks that Juliet is crying over Tybalt’s death.
What plan does Lady Capulet have for Romeo? She plans on sending a man to Mantua with poison that will kill Romeo.
How does Lord Capulet react to the news that Juliet will not marry Paris? He is furious! He starts yelling at her that he will disown her and throw her out onto the streets if she does not marry Paris.
What advice does the nurse give? She tells Juliet that Juliet should marry Paris.
Where is Juliet going at the end of the scene? Juliet is going to Friar Lawrence’s cell. She tells the nurse to tell her parents that she is going to confession.
The Prince sentences Romeo to Romeo is banished from Verona.
